2025 NFL Draft Prospect Interview: CJ Brown, DB, Kutztown University

2025 NFL Draft Prospect Interview: CJ Brown, DB, Kutztown University
Meet 2025 NFL Draft prospect CJ Brown from Kutztown University. Discover what makes him a top safety in the draft.
  • Name: CJ Brown
  • Position: Safety/ Nickel
  • College: Kutztown University
  • Height: 6’0
  • Weight: 198
  • Twitter: cj_brown1
  • Instagram: cj.brown2

What makes you a top prospect at your position in the 2025 NFL Draft

I’m a top prospect in the 2025 NFL Draft because I’m not just built for the game—I embody it. My mindset always has been “Win the rep. Win the down. Win the game.” I’m not chasing greatness—I’m carving a lane no one’s ever run in before. That’s what makes me different. That’s what makes me next.

What is one thing that NFL teams should know about you?

One thing NFL teams should know about me: I don’t need motivation I have it within me. Every time I step on the field, I bring relentless energy and a mindset that refuses to settle. I don’t just want to be part of a franchise…I want to be the reason it wins. Same as I have done in High School and College. 

If you could donate to one cause in the world, what would it be? 

Breast Cancer awareness. It has affected many people in my family and close friends so being able to give to that will be an outstanding feeling. 

Who was your role model? 

My parents and sisters. They showed me how to be a hard worker and also how to treat others and expect nothing in return. 

Who is your favorite NFL team?

Kansas City Chiefs I always liked them cause their colors and name was similar to my hometown (we were Red Raiders but our simple was the arrowhead) Also, all my life I have been an Andy Reid fan mostly. Being close to Philly I was always pushed towards eagles but I always admired how Andy ran his team. 

Who is the most underrated teammate at your school? 

Steven Burkhardt aka Sharky. The way that kid runs the football and puts in work off the field is special. 

What is your biggest pet peeve? 

Disrespecting your parents simple. 

Who is your favorite teacher ever?

I would say Mrs. Wolf just cause she was truly very understanding and empathetic. After my freshman season I made sure to go say Hi to her first. 

Overcoming adversity is what defines character, what was the hardest moment in your life to overcome? 

January 2023 I lost my brother and grandma in the same week. It was also my last semester before graduation. So having to put that down and find the drive to finish strong was challenging. 

If you could have any franchise restaurant in your house what would it be?

Texas Roadhouse just cause the butter buns and the wide variety of food options. It’s unmatched.

What is your favorite snack food? 

Sliced fruit (berries, apples, pineapple)

What is your degree in? 

Communication Studies with a minor in Psychology 

If you could have dinner with three people dead or alive, who would it be and why? 

Jesus Christ because he is the king of all kings and greatest human to ever live. Jackie Robinson because his resilience and patience was astonishing. Always looked up to Jackie. Lastly, LeBron James cause he is literally the best athlete to ever play his sport. 

What is your biggest weakness?

Trying to handle everything alone. Often times I feel as though I don’t need anyone and I can do it myself. That’s not true. The most successful person ever has not done it alone.
